About Us:

Abcam is a leading web-based business supplying antibodies to life scientists worldwide. Our head office is in Cambridge (UK), we also have offices in Bristol (UK), Cambridge, Eugene and San Francisco, (USA), Tokyo (Japan), Hong Kong, Shanghai and Hangzhou (China).

It's an exciting time at Abcam, with a big focus on the IT Department as we are currently the key enabler for a Business Transformation project and implementing a new ERP system. This is a fast moving programme and we are implementing the right technologies, processes and decisions for the future growth of Abcam.

Within IT, we follow the Agile methodology predominantly, and also TDD and Continuous Integration; alongside other methodologies such as Waterfall. There are diverse set of skills, knowledge and experience within the Programme Team, focussing on Project Management, Business Analysis and Project Analysis, which help support the IT function in delivering key projects to Abcam.

About the role:

We're looking for a Technical BA to join us for a fixed term contract of approximately 9-12 months during a journey of multi-year investment in our core IT systems.

In this role we’re looking for someone to carry out a variety of tasks including:

Supporting the Project Manager during the Inception of the projects

Collecting the requirements from the Business and the IT teams through workshops

Meetings and documentation, writing user stories and business acceptance criteria for Developers and QA Analysts

Planning the iterations, working with the whole project team for the completion of the stories and organising the UAT and supporting the systems developed by the project for a finite time after completion.

Skills and Experience you will need:

Have worked within an Agile environment and within a business with a web application development focus and software product implementation.

Have a strong understanding of the longer term delivery of business projects end to end.

Be able to influence and engage stakeholders and team members to reach common goals and develop strong working relationships throughout the business.

Multi-tasking must be a strong point as must prioritisation, as you will be working on multiple projects simultaneously. As you’ll be joining a fast paced environment you must be comfortable with hitting the ground running.
